Every child deserves the confidence to smile, speak, and dream without limits. With this in mind, Smile Train Philippines brought together children, families, healthcare partners, advocates, and communities on August 14 for Beyond the Smile, a community fair for cleft awareness.

The event served as a day of learning, connection, and empowerment that highlighted comprehensive cleft care and inspired more Filipinos to champion inclusion.  It featured a range of engaging activities, including an educational kiosk that helped visitors better understand cleft conditions and comprehensive cleft care, cleft care discovery sessions showcasing Smile Train’s life-changing services, a patient support and referral desk that connected families to available care, and a fireside chat where patients, families, healthcare professionals, and advocates shared stories of hope and resilience. Through these activities, attendees gained a deeper understanding of cleft conditions, helped dismiss common misconceptions, and discovered how they could contribute to building a more inclusive community.

 

The need for greater awareness remains significant 

Every three minutes, a child is born with a cleft. According to the World Health Organization (WHO), cleft lip and palate are among the world’s most common birth differences and are highly treatable, yet many families continue to face barriers to accessing timely, comprehensive care.

That is why Beyond the Smile is a call to action to ensure that no child is left behind. It calls for greater collaboration to expand access to quality cleft care while fostering more inclusive communities where every child feels valued, supported, and empowered to succeed.

“Clefts affect far more than a child’s outward appearance; it impacts even basic functions like breathing and eating, and even their well-being as they grow into adulthood. Comprehensive cleft care includes essential treatments beyond cleft surgery, such as nutritional support, speech therapy, specialized orthodontics and dental work, hearing care, and psychosocial counseling – all important towards ensuring people with clefts not just live but thrive,” said John Manuel Flores, Smile Train’s Area Director for Southeast Asia.

“Children with clefts also need systems of support that continue long after treatment,” Flores added. “With families, healthcare professionals, schools, and communities working together, we create communities where every child feels accepted, included, and supported. That is why every conversation, every partnership, and every act of understanding helps bring us closer to a future where every child born with a cleft has access to the care they need and the opportunity to live without limits.”  

 

How Smile Train is Making it Happen 

For many families, receiving a cleft diagnosis can feel overwhelming. Through Smile Train’s network of local hospital partners and healthcare professionals, the organization helps ensure that children receive comprehensive cleft care and address their needs at every stage of their journey.

Recognizing that awareness begins beyond healthcare settings, Smile Train Philippines also partnered with the REX Education Foundation Inc. (REFI) to expand cleft education through literacy and community-based initiatives. The partnership helps equip children, schools, and local communities with a better understanding of cleft conditions while promoting empathy, acceptance, and inclusion.

“Education has the power to shape not only what children know, but also how they see and treat others,” said Dominic Leandre D. Buhain, Vice Chairman of REX Education Foundation Inc. “Through our partnership with Smile Train Philippines, we hope to foster greater understanding of cleft conditions at an early age, helping nurture classrooms and communities where every child feels respected, included, and empowered to thrive.”
